Archives of old Communique issues now available

Posted by Jill Bogler-Patterson on July 18, 2021
Posted in: Uncategorized. Tagged: Captain's Logs.

One thing I want to do as Captain is to keep the legacy of the USS Kelly alive. As part of that, I wanted to find and share our old newsletters. Thanks to Admiral Carl Stark, I was able to get most of our back issues (from volume 1 through volume 68) up on our Website. You may have noticed a few changes because of it.

As I was perusing these old issues, I was remembering when I joined the USS Kelly. I remembered being asked to write an article and that it was published. Well, I found it. I didn’t put my name on the article in the issue, but I distinctly remember that it was about the Tenctonese (the aliens in Alien Nation) and that I wrote it like a bunch of various logs. I wanted to share that with you… so here it is.

Tenctonese article from vol 26Download

This article was published the first part of 1994, and was in the first issue of the Communique published after I joined in December 1993. Sometimes I forget how much time has passed since I joined this organization. A lot has changed, but a lot remains the same – namely the friendships I’ve made along the way. I hope that you find the same enjoyment with the USS Kelly as I have over the past two-and-a-half decades.
